Commercial Remodeling FAQs
What Is Commercial Remodeling?
Commercial remodeling is the process of making over or renovating a space that is zoned as commercial property. This can refer to a variety of properties such as those used for retail sales, office spaces, multi-purpose spaces like medical offices, multi-unit living units like apartments or condos, and other properties that are not residential properties.
How Does Commercial Remodeling Differ From Residential Remodeling?
While commercial remodeling involves the same basic process as residential remodeling, it is focused more on making and keeping spaces income-producing. The goal is to improve the appearance and increase the usefulness of a space without as much of a focus on personal comforts. The components and materials chosen are usually more durable for commercial or industrial use as opposed to personal use and decisions are made to accommodate the more intense usage that these places experience.

What Types of Properties Might Benefit From Commercial Remodeling?
Commercial remodeling is appropriate for any type of commercial property that requires updating, improving, or re-designing so it can better suit an incoming business or resident tenant in some way:
- Multi-Unit Housing - Apartments and condos require frequent remodeling as the years pass to keep them in good repair and up-to-date. When property owners invest in periodic remodeling of their rental properties, they can consistently rent their units, reduce vacancies, and many times lease them at more competitive rates.
- Office, Retail, and Professional Space - For many owners of office buildings or other professional spaces, build-outs to suit an incoming tenant’s needs can be an important commercial remodeling project to make the space usable by a desirable tenant. Companies that own their own buildings might also consider periodic commercial remodeling to make their spaces more useful to how their business runs and provide a more comfortable and efficient workspace for their employees.
What Benefits Are Gained After Properties Undergo Commercial Remodeling?
Depending on the type of property, commercial remodeling can bring many benefits to the property owner. Since people typically invest in commercial property to rent or lease it, a freshly remodeled property that is up-to-date in terms of appearance, appliances, and other details can be rented at a higher rate or even attract a higher caliber business tenant when leasing professional or retail space. Apartments and condos that are freshly remodeled will rent faster and longer at higher rates.
Additionally, remodeling commercial properties allow property owners to update to more efficient or environmentally friendly components that can provide added benefits for tenants and property owners alike. A commercial remodeling project that makes any workspace more employee-friendly is an investment in company productivity and profitability. Some businesses may even benefit from tax incentives depending on the types of remodels they make to their investment properties. Overall, remodeled and up-to-date properties are worth more, too.

Must The Property Be Vacated While Commercial Remodeling Is Going On?
Whether or not a commercial property must be vacated for the work to be performed will depend on the space being remodeled and the scope of the remodeling project. Apartment, condo, and other living space remodels are more easily accomplished when they are vacant; however, corporate and retail spaces can frequently be remodeled in sections without suspending work completely. In either case, clients can discuss with their project manager how they should prepare for the remodeling work to begin and what they can expect as far as needing to vacate the space.
Are Permits Necessary For Commercial Remodeling?
In most cities and towns in Texas, permits are required for any type of major remodeling, whether residential or commercial. Permits are especially important for commercial remodeling work as the work being performed may require adherence to building code laws that are different than those for residential remodeling.
